Job Summary
Job Description
Responsible for the daily administration and operation of the warehouse. Oversee materials are received, stored, shipped and reported in accordance with established procedures. Direct and supervise warehouse staff. Review effectiveness of operating procedures, maintenance, space utilization and protection of equipment.
Administer and oversee the daily operation of the warehouse including processing, packaging and storage of supplies, materials and equipment. Ensure overtime is maintained within budget allotted. - Oversee receipt, storage and shipment of materials and related reporting in accordance with established procedures. Ensure the accuracy of the inventory.
Account for all materials and supplies in the stores facilities. Audit goods received into warehouse.
Coach and mentor team members in the areas of productivity, quality, safety and Medline Core Values.
Ensure all routine paperwork is completed on time and are filled out accurately.
Assist the warehouse manager in maintaining a safe work environment for all team members.
Lead day-to-day activities of employees. Assign, monitor and review progress and accuracy of work, directs efforts and provides technical guidance on more complex issues. Provide input into hiring, firing and performance reviews.
Work with customer service to resolve warehouse related issues.
Medline offers a business casual, entrepreneurial work environment with strong growth potential, a competitive compensation package, and a complete benefits package including medical/dental/vision/life insurance; 401(k) with company match. And much more!
Education:
High school diploma or equivalent, Associate’s degree a plus.
Relevant Work Experience:
At least 3 years of supervisory experience coaching, mentoring and training staff. - At least 3 years warehouse experience. Basic skill level.

Warehouse Jobs in Kansas City: Frequently Asked Questions
How do I get a warehouse job in Kansas City?
Focus your search on North Kansas City, the East Bottoms industrial district, and the freight corridors near KCI Airport, where logistics, food distribution, and e-commerce fulfillment employers hire the most. Forklift certification, experience with pick-and-pack or receiving, and familiarity with inventory management systems give candidates a real edge in this market. Applying directly to distribution centers along I-70 and I-435 is often faster than waiting for agency placements.

Are there remote warehouse jobs in Kansas City?
Yes, but only for a narrow slice of the field. Hands-on roles like receiving, picking, and loading are by definition on-site, while inventory control, warehouse coordinator, and supply chain analyst positions can sometimes be remote or hybrid. How can I get a warehouse job in Kansas City with little or no experience?
The most realistic entry point is a seasonal or temp-to-hire role through one of the staffing agencies serving Kansas City's North Industrial District or the Eastport logistics zone, where employers regularly convert temporary workers to full-time after 60 to 90 days. Entry-level picker, loader, and material handler roles require no prior experience and serve as the main door into full-time positions. Completing a free forklift safety course through Kansas City community programs adds immediate value to an application.
